Modeling of Air-Mist Spray in the Continuous Casting of Steel (Room 208 A)

Intense and uniform spray cooling in continuous casting is beneficial to forming high-strength steel. Air-mist spray is one of the promising technologies to achieve high-rate heat transfer due to the significant reduction in water droplet size, as a result of the strong air-water interaction in the spray nozzle. The current study numerically investigated the air-water interaction, water droplet formation and droplet-slab impingement heat transfer in order to fully understand the mechanism of the high heat transfer rate by air-mist spray compared to the conventional hydraulic spray and to provide guidance for the operation of air-mist spray.
